Abandoned and partly removed larvikite quarry with syenite pegmatites situated in Tvedalen, 10Β km W of the town of Larvik.

β Hydrocerussite Formula: Pb3(CO3)2(OH)2 Colour: white Description: As small (~1/25mm) crystals forminy crust on leadhillite. |
β 'K Feldspar' Description: Listed as orthoclase in Γ
mli & Griffin (1972). Analysed K-feldspar elsewhere in Tvedalen is shown to be microcline. |
β Leadhillite Formula: Pb4(CO3)2(SO4)(OH)2 Habit: ~1mm grain Description: One grain of leadhillite was found inside a cavity in a corroded galena crystal. |
